I got these to tune out the drone of my AC unit while I work & game, and they work generally really well. The ANC is about on par with older Sonys, maybe not as good as the newer ones, but these have Sonys beat hands down on sound and build quality. I also love the fact that basically every Bluetooth codec is supported – Sony doesn’t support aptX Low Latency – so if you have a suitable receiver you can use whatever setup you like. I keep mine on LL even though my receiver supports HD as well, can’t tell any quality difference with my use cases.

I bought them because I was looking for a new headset.I owned a Sennheiser PCX 550, which is good value, decent noise cancellation (NC).I tried the Sony WH-1000XM3, the NC is very good (the best so far for me), but unfortunately they get quite warm over the ears after a while; I had to return them.So I tried the Aonic 50; I had high expectation: I own a BT2 wireless headset; which I am very happy with.But the Aonic 50 – it just not great for me: heavier and clunky; but most of all: the NC is really subpar. I tried them when walking, and everytime I made a step, I could hear a thump in the headphones. Apparently the NC captured the shock of my feet. I returned them.I ended up getting the new PCX550 II, which is good value in the end, though the NC is not as good as the Sony’s but at least I can wear them for many hours with discomfort.
